“…Decreased sensitivity of peripheral tissues to insulin seems well established. The results of forearm perfusion studies (1)(2)(3), the presence of elevated fasting immunoreactive insulin levels in uremia (4)(5)(6)(7)(8)(9), and the delayed and diminished glucose response after exogenous insulin (5,(9)(10)(11)(12)(13)(14)(15) and tolbutamide (4,9,11,(14)(15)(16) indicate the presence of insulin resistance in the majority of patients with chronic renal failure. In contrast, conflicting reports have appeared on the plasma insulin response to intravenous and oral glucose in uremia.…”
